Tailored Learning Management System Development: Adapting Training for our Nation

The need for responsive and customized learning solutions is increasingly apparent across various sectors in our country. Off-the-shelf LMS often fall short when it comes to addressing the unique challenges and opportunities found within the South African context, such as language diversity, cultural nuances, and uneven digital access. Consequently, custom Learning Management Systems development offers a powerful route to implement learning experiences that are genuinely aligned with the needs of businesses, employees, and the national landscape. This strategy allows for inclusion of key elements such as mobile accessibility, support for offline learning, and localized content, ultimately boosting educational results and return on investment.

Constructing a Learning Management Framework in South Africa

The need for robust and accessible online learning is increasingly evident in South Africa, driving a surge in demand for bespoke Learning Management Frameworks. Building a successful LMS within the South African context requires careful assessment of unique challenges, including limited internet access in certain areas, diverse language requirements, and the imperative to align with national standards. Local programmers are shifting to create systems that are not only effective but also budget-friendly, often utilizing open-source platforms and cloud-based hosting to reduce costs and maximize reach. Furthermore, a focus on mobile-first architecture is critical given the prevalence of mobile devices for usage across the region.
